首页前端开发CSScss 如何建立一个搜索框

css 如何建立一个搜索框

时间2023-11-17 05:09:03发布访客分类CSS浏览615
导读:在编写网站时,搜索框是一个非常重要的元素。通过添加一些CSS代码,你可以将搜索框的外观设计变得非常吸引人和功能性强大。以下是如何通过CSS建立一个搜索框的方法。.search-box { display: flex; align-ite...

在编写网站时,搜索框是一个非常重要的元素。通过添加一些CSS代码,你可以将搜索框的外观设计变得非常吸引人和功能性强大。以下是如何通过CSS建立一个搜索框的方法。

.search-box {
      display: flex;
      align-items: center;
      justify-content: center;
      width: 300px;
      height: 40px;
      background-color: #F8F8F8;
      border-radius: 20px;
}
.search-box input {
      border: none;
      width: 250px;
      height: 30px;
      background: none;
      font-size: 16px;
      outline: none;
      margin-left: 10px;
}
.search-box button {
      border: none;
      background: none;
      outline: none;
      cursor: pointer;
}
.search-box button img {
      width: 20px;
      height: 20px;
      margin-right: 10px;
}
    

首先,我们需要创造一个容器来包含搜索框。这里我们使用的是类选择器".search-box"。

我们采用了 flexbox 布局来让盒子和里面的元素相对居中。这样做是为了在不同的设备上保证搜索框能够自动调整大小。

为了使搜索框看起来更加美观,我们添加了灰色的背景颜色和圆角。接下来,在搜索框容器里面创建一个文本输入框和一个搜索按钮

文本输入框规则如下:

  • 将边框设置为无
  • 将文本框背景设置为透明
  • 调整宽度和高度
  • 将默认字体设置为16像素
  • 去掉焦点样式

搜索按钮规则如下:

  • 将边框设置为无
  • 将背景设置为透明
  • 去掉焦点样式
  • 在按钮里面插入一个图片搜索符号

通过这些CSS规则,你可以轻松地建立一个功能强大而美观的搜索框。记得在你的网站搜索框中添加相应的HTML代码,以显示此搜索框。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: css 如何建立一个搜索框
本文地址: https://pptw.com/jishu/542716.html
html代码怎么在网页上展示 html代码在线预览效果

游客 回复需填写必要信息